This tall ornamental tree makes an impressive focal point near a water feature. Yellow Buckeye (Aesculus flava (formerly Aesculus octandra)) is an exceptional native plant that delivers a beautiful spring bloom!

You won't believe your eyes! Large, 7-inch tall upright-growing yellow flowering panicles cover the oval canopy and bring butterflies and hummingbirds.

Yellow Buckeye also features very attractive, pinnately compound leaves. Five elliptical leaflets are held on a single petiole and are boldly textured from a strong midrib. Lustrous and dark green all summer long!

This tree gives an impression of strength. As the tree ages, the gray bark develops a distinctive texture and the caliper of the trunk expands wide. The flowers transform into smooth fruit that contains shiny brown seeds. Perhaps you carried one or more in your pocket as a child to bring you good luck. Or you can leave them to the wildlife that depend on the autumn bounty!

As the temperatures start to dip in fall, Yellow Buckeye delivers another phenomenal ornamental display. Enjoy watching the setting sun spotlight the glowing leaves, which develop a range of fiery hues, from orange to bronze ... to golden-yellow!

#ProPlantTips for Care:

A North American native, the Yellow Buckeye grows best along stream beds in full sun or partial shade in more average moisture sites They do prefer to be planted in moist, well-drained rich soil with a 3-4 inch deep layer of mulch around their root zone. Prune after flowering should you need to shape, but major pruning should be done when dormant. These hardy natives are not susceptible to many foliage diseases, resist leaf scorch, nor need much in the way of maintenance! Plus these trees are wonderfully urban environment tolerant!
